On 03/30/2015 10:00 PM, Anuj Phogat wrote:
> I'm still passing tiling=I915_TILING_Y in drm_intel_gem_bo_alloc_internal()
> in case of YF/YS tiling. Passing tiling=I915_TILING_{YF,YS} causes bo
> allocation failure. Any advice what's the right thing to do here?

Officially approved idea is to pass I915_TILING_NONE to the kernel since 
it doesn't need to know. (It is not possible to map Yf/Ys into GTT for 
de-tiling.)
